How to Transfer Mew from the Poké Ball Plus (Pokémon: Let’s Go, Pikachu! / Pokémon: Let’s Go, Eevee!)
Read on below for instructions on transferring the Mythical Pokémon Mew from a Poké Ball Plus to Pokémon: Let’s Go, Pikachu! or Pokémon: Let’s Go, Eevee!.
Important:
- If you transfer Mew to your game, then delete the save file – you will also delete Mew. You will not be able to get Mew again on a new game from the same Poké Ball Plus. Please consider this before deleting or restarting your game.
Additional Information:
- Mew can only be transferred ONE TIME, into one copy of Pokémon: Let’s Go, Pikachu! or Pokémon: Let’s Go, Eevee!.
- Once it has been transferred to a game, it will no longer be available on the Poké Ball Plus to transfer again to a different game.
- The option to transfer Mew becomes available after you have battled your Rival for the first time. Before then, the “Communicate” menu option will be grayed out.
Complete These Steps:
- Verify that the Poké Ball Plus contains Mew.
- Press and hold the control stick button on the Poké Ball Plus for a few seconds, then let go.
- The ring around the control stick button will light up as a pink / purple color and make a sound like Mew laughing. (You can also shake the Poké Ball Plus to hear Mew’s voice.)
- The colored ring will flash about once per second if it contains a Mew that has not yet been transferred to a game.
- Launch Pokémon: Let’s Go, Pikachu! or Pokémon: Let’s Go, Eevee! from the Nintendo Switch HOME Menu.
- Use the Poké Ball Plus as your in-game controller.
- Press the Top Button on the Poké Ball Plus during gameplay to access the in-game menu.
- Select “Communicate.”
- This option becomes available after you have battled your Rival for the first time.
- Select “Mystery Gifts.”
- Select “Get with a Poké Ball Plus.”
- This option will only appear when you are using the Poké Ball Plus as your in-game controller.
- You will see a message that says: “A Pokémon is in your Poké Ball Plus. It’s a present for you!” Select “Yes” twice to connect to the Internet and receive the Pokémon.
- Once you have received a gift, it will be in your Pokémon Box and you can add it to your party.
- To change Pokémon in your party, press the X Button to open the in-game menu, then “Party.” Select “Open Pokémon Box” to see and manage the Pokémon you’ve collected.
